The Process for Becoming an Advisory Board, Commission or Committee Member <br />Community members submit a completed Boards and Commissions application to the <br />Mayor's Office. The Mayor's Office will forward the application to the applicable Board(s) or <br />Commission(s) for review. The Mayor recommends appointment of applicants to the <br />advisory group and the appointments are confirmed by the City Council. <br />Terms and Reappointments <br />Terms of service vary by Board or Commission and range from annually to 6 years. Vacancies <br />are filled throughout the year as needed. An individual may be reappointed for additional <br />terms of service with the approval of the Mayor and City Council. <br />Resignations <br />If an advisory member is unable to complete their term of service a letter of resignation <br />should be sent to the Mayor indicating the effective date of the resignation. <br />Roles and Responsibilities <br />Each member of a Board or Commission makes unique contributions, but some members <br />may assume additional roles within the group. Each role that people fill within these groups <br />has guidelines that help ensure success. The following are general guidelines that may vary <br />with the requirements or need of each group. <br />Chair /Vice -Chair <br />• As group leader, the chair suggests group direction and options for setting goals <br />• Provides a supportive environment for process, content, and group members <br />• Sees that agendas are set <br />• Sets a positive tone and pace for the group <br />• May share the role of meeting preparation with the advisory group staff person <br />• Represents the group in the community <br />Group Member <br />• Arranges adequate time to carry out responsibility as a group member <br />• Comes to meetings prepared <br />• Listens to other group members and communicates with respect and courtesy <br />• Participates in group discussion and decision making <br />Staff Support for Advisory Groups <br />City staff support the City of Tukwila advisory groups. The primary role of staff is to represent <br />the City and facilitate communication between the advisory group, City Administration, the <br />City Council and other City departments.
